Role Overview:
- Act as lineside quality authority for hardware inspection and acceptance
· Own in-process and final inspection, buy-offs, and release decisions
· Ensure hardware meets drawing, spec, and workmanship requirements
· Execute quality control within ERP/MES systems (review, sign-off, traceability)
· Serve as primary POC for manufacturing quality issues on the floor
Responsibilities:
- Inspection & Buy-Off Authority
- Perform in-process and final inspection of hardware (mechanical + electrical)
- Execute first article inspection (FAI) and verification against drawings/specs
- Approve/reject hardware and sign off on build completion
- Quality Control Execution
- Review travelers, routers, and build records in ERP/MES
- Ensure traceability, configuration, and documentation are complete and accurate
- Enforce workmanship standards (IPC, internal specs)
- Nonconformance & Disposition
- Identify, document, and segregate nonconforming material
- Support MRB and disposition activities
- Drive immediate containment on the floor
- Production Support
- Act as first responder to quality issues during builds
- Interface directly with Manufacturing, Test, and Engineering
- Ensure no hardware progresses with unresolved quality issues
Minimum Requirements:
- 5+ years in quality inspection / QC / manufacturing quality roles
- Experience with board-level and/or mechanical hardware inspection
- Ability to read drawings, schematics, and specifications (GD&T preferred)
- Experience with ERP/MES systems for build tracking and sign-off
- Familiarity with IPC standards (J-STD-001, IPC-A-610)
Preferred Requirements:
- Experience in aerospace/defense or high-reliability hardware
- Experience in multiple production domains (R&D, T2P, LRIP, FRP)
- AS9100 environment experience, Experience performing FAI (AS9102)
- Strong MRB / nonconformance handling experience
